The industrial packaging sector in Israel is currently undergoing a significant paradigm shift. Driven by the "Israel 2040" infrastructure vision and strict environmental regulations from the Ministry of Environmental Protection, manufacturers are moving away from single-use plastics toward high-performance, recyclable Multiwall Kraft Paper Bags.
From the high-density urban developments in Tel Aviv to the specialized chemical extraction industries near the Dead Sea, the demand for packaging that can withstand high temperatures and varying humidity is paramount. Multiwall bags, particularly those with PE-liners or moisture-barrier coatings, are essential for transporting cement, dry mortar, and mineral additives used in Israel's innovative building technologies.
